Reinforcement Learning Toolbox 2.0
last updated:
General
Documentation
Manual
Tutorial
Class Reference
Master Thesis
Examples
Related Papers
Downloads
Links
News
mailto:webmaster
Main Page     Class Hierarchy   Compound List   File List   Compound Members   File Members

CExtraTreesSplittingConditionFactory Class Reference

#include <cextratrees.h>

Inheritance diagram for CExtraTreesSplittingConditionFactory:

CSplittingConditionFactory List of all members.


Public Member Functions

  CExtraTreesSplittingConditionFactory (CDataSet *inputData, CDataSet1D *outputData, unsigned int K, unsigned int n_min, double outTresh=0.0, CDataSet1D *weightingData=NULL)
virtual  ~CExtraTreesSplittingConditionFactory ()
virtual CSplittingCondition createSplittingCondition (DataSubset *dataSubset)
virtual bool  isLeaf (DataSubset *dataSubset)


Protected Member Functions

double  getScore (CSplittingCondition *condition, DataSubset *dataSubset)


Protected Attributes

unsigned int  K
unsigned int  n_min
double  outTreshold
CDataSet inputData
CDataSet1D outputData
CDataSet1D weightingData

Constructor & Destructor Documentation

CExtraTreesSplittingConditionFactory::CExtraTreesSplittingConditionFactory CDataSet inputData,
CDataSet1D outputData,
unsigned int  K,
unsigned int  n_min,
double  outTresh = 0.0,
CDataSet1D weightingData = NULL
 
virtual CExtraTreesSplittingConditionFactory::~CExtraTreesSplittingConditionFactory  )  [virtual]
 

Member Function Documentation

virtual CSplittingCondition* CExtraTreesSplittingConditionFactory::createSplittingCondition DataSubset dataSubset  )  [virtual]
 

Implements CSplittingConditionFactory.

double CExtraTreesSplittingConditionFactory::getScore CSplittingCondition condition,
DataSubset dataSubset
[protected]
 
virtual bool CExtraTreesSplittingConditionFactory::isLeaf DataSubset dataSubset  )  [virtual]
 

Implements CSplittingConditionFactory.


Member Data Documentation

CDataSet* CExtraTreesSplittingConditionFactory::inputData [protected]
 
unsigned int CExtraTreesSplittingConditionFactory::K [protected]
 
unsigned int CExtraTreesSplittingConditionFactory::n_min [protected]
 
CDataSet1D* CExtraTreesSplittingConditionFactory::outputData [protected]
 
double CExtraTreesSplittingConditionFactory::outTreshold [protected]
 
CDataSet1D* CExtraTreesSplittingConditionFactory::weightingData [protected]
 

The documentation for this class was generated from the following file: